Avoid common mistakes in overseas news marketing

Overseas news marketing can be a daunting task, especially for businesses unfamiliar with the nuances of international audiences. A common pitfall is failing to understand the cultural differences and local news consumption habits. This can lead to missteps that damage your brand&039;s reputation. To avoid common mistakes in overseas news marketing, it’s crucial to tailor your strategy to each market.

Firstly, many companies make the mistake of treating all overseas markets as a single entity. This is a major oversight. Each country has its own unique cultural and political landscape. For instance, what works in the United States might not resonate in China due to different social media platforms and consumer behaviors. Understanding these differences is key to crafting a successful overseas marketing campaign.

Secondly, companies often overlook the importance of local partnerships and influencers. In today’s digital age, word-of-mouth marketing plays a significant role. Partnering with local influencers can help you reach a broader audience and build trust. For example, when a well-known Chinese influencer promoted a product on Weibo, it led to a surge in sales among young consumers who trusted their recommendations.

Another common mistake is failing to localize your content effectively. Simply translating your existing content into another language is not enough. You need to ensure that the message resonates with the local audience in terms of language style, tone, and cultural references. A good example is how McDonald’s adjusted its menu offerings in different countries based on local tastes and preferences.

Lastly, ignoring data analytics can be detrimental to your overseas marketing efforts. Monitoring key performance indicators (KPIs) such as engagement r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ates will help you refine your strategy over time. Tools like Google Analytics and social media insights provide valuable data that can guide your decisions.

In conclusion, avoiding common mistakes in overseas news marketing requires careful planning and execution. By understanding cultural differences, leveraging local partnerships, localizing content effectively, and utilizing data analytics, you can create successful campaigns that resonate with international audiences.
